Notes

Version I: Fermentation start very slow, un-Kveiklike. Dry cuked with 2 lbs peeled cucumbers after fermentation. 1.051 OG 1.006 FG. Loral hops.

Version II as described above. The recipe below from u/DrMarigold was my starting point or inspiration point!

"u/DrMarigold--
A couple weeks ago, I posted a recipe for a cucumber cream ale which ended up tasting amazing. The beer was my attempt at a clone of Mill House Brewing Company's "Cucumber Blessings", and I just so happened to run into one of their head brewers at my job! I told him about my recipe and he gave me some advice, so now I present to you my new and improved Cucumber Cream Ale.

1 Gallon Batch

Mash: 1.6lbs Local Pilsner .3lbs Flaked Corn .1lbs Carmel 10 Half of a sliced english cucumber, diced

Boil: .1oz Cascade @ 60 .1oz Motueka @ 30 .1oz Motueka @ 15 .1oz Motueka @ 5 Zest of 1 lime @ 5

Safale - 05

Infuse with additional half of a diced cucumber soaked in 1/4 cup of gin for 3 days at Secondary fermentation."
